With All Deliberate Speed: Implementing Brown v. Board of Education * Edited by Brian J. Daugherity and Charles C. Bolton * Fayetteville: University of Arkansas Press, 2008 * xvi, 340 pp. * $64.95 cloth; $24.95 paper
There is no absence of literature on the epochal Supreme Court case Brown v. Board of Education. The fiftieth anniversary of the decision in 2004 in particular saw an explosion of books, journal articles, essays, conference panels, symposia, and lectures on the meaning and influence of the case. Many were laudatory of Brown v. Board as a vital moment in the history of the struggle against white supremacy in America. More than a few used the anniversary to investigate how far we had come, or not come. But remarkably little of the voluminous work on Brown has addressed the actual implementation of the court's desegregation decision.
